Late-Race Engine failure leaves LeBrocq last at Sydney Motorsport Park

Jack LeBrocq picked up the 15th last-place finish of his career when his #9 Wake-Up Chevrolet retired with Engine failure after 47 of the race’s 51 laps. The finish came in LeBrocq’s 222nd start and is LeBrocq’s second last-place finish this season.

 

Jack LeBrocq is in his 7th full-time season and is one of the five drivers who came through in 2018 alongside Richie Stanaway, Anton De Pasquale, Todd Hazelwood and James Golding. Technically, Jack is one of only two drivers who have had a ride through his seven years, with Stanaway and Golding in their second entry into the main game, which Hazelwood was called up at the last minute to Erebus Motorsports to cover Brodie Kostecki after the latter stopped racing unexpectedly. Jack LeBrocq started at Tekno Autosports, then switched to Tickford Racing for 2020 and 2021, where he won his first race. LeBrocq then moved to Matt Stone Racing in 2022. In 2023, he won his second race before moving to Erebus Motorsports in 2024. LeBrocq was 16th in the weekend’s only Practice session and Qualified 20th.

 

Aaron Love in the #3 Cooldrive Distribution Ford started the race from the rear after steering issues ended his qualifying. At Turn 2 on Lap 1, Macauley Jones in the #96 Pizza Hut Chevrolet tangled with Mark Winterbottom in the #18 DeWalt Chevrolet, sending both off and Frosty to last. Frosty would pull into the garage the following lap with right-front damage, losing nine laps in repairs.

 

The race for the rest of the Bottom Five spread across the race. Pitstops began on Lap 13 when Brodie Kostecki in the #1 SS Signs Chevrolet pitted and fell to second last, then Tim Slade in the #23 Nulon Chevrolet pitted on Lap 14, then Aaron Love in the #3 Cooldrive Distribution Ford pitted on Lap 15, then James Courtney in the #7 Snowy River Caravans Ford pitted on lap 18. Macaulay Jones in the #96 Pizza Hut Chevrolet would wind up second last after depending on lap 25.

 

Jones would remain second last until lap 30 when Tim Slade in the #23 Nulon Chevrolet pitted for a second time and dropped behind Macca. After an early race spin, David Reynolds in the #20 Tradie Chevrolet pitted on lap 31 and fell behind Slade. Aaron Love would pit lap 33, followed by Lochie Dalton in the #7 Fiducian Ford after their second pitstop.

 

Just as it seemed like Frosty would finish last, Jack LeBrocq in the #9 Wake-Up Chevrolet suffered engine failure with four laps to go, ending his race and leaving him last despite completing more laps than Frosty. Completing the Bottom five was Aaron Love in the #3 Cooldrive Distribution Ford, Lochie Dalton in the #5 Fiducian Ford and James Courtney in the #7 Snowy River Caravans Ford.
